给定文件树
X / Y / A.TXT
如何将文件移至
X / A.TXT
右键单击文件时,我只看到删除并重命名,但不是移动命令。 谷歌搜索没有透露任何相关信息。 我使用vscode 1.6.1
更新:目前无法将文件和文件夹移动到根文件夹:https://github.com/Microsoft/vscode/issues/1043
答案 0 :(得分:9)
你可以使用drag n'删除以移动文件
答案 1 :(得分:4)
从Visual Studio Code Marketplace安装File Utils后,通过右键单击侧栏中的文件可以进行移动。
答案 2 :(得分:3)
您还可以在代码中使用控制台(例如PowerShell或Git Bash)移动文件。
最近我习惯在侧栏中移动文件或文件夹,通过ctrl + x(剪切)和ctrl + v(粘贴),此操作后代码自动更新导入。
拖动& drop方法也有效。
答案 3 :(得分:2)
由VSCode v1.37(2019)解决的OP issue 1043
该功能仍在改进,issue 98309:“在工作副本文件服务中支持多个文件”。
请参见PR 98988“文件操作事件支持多种资源”
这允许在移动几个文件时正确更新依赖于移动的其他文件。
这样可以避免这种情况: